Andrea Evans, ‘One Life to Live’ Star, Passes Away at 66 after Battle with Breast Cancer

Andrea Evans, renowned for her roles on “One Life to Live,” “Passions,” and “The Bold and The Beautiful,” has sadly passed away at the age of 66. The soap opera star, known for her portrayal of Tina Lord, died at her home in Pasadena, California, following a battle with breast cancer. The news was confirmed by her former manager, Don Carroll, who highlighted Evans’ loving nature and her devotion to her family and friends.

A Talented Actress and Beloved Colleague:

Nick Leicht, Evans’ current manager, expressed his condolences and described her as a remarkable talent and a joy to work with. Evans rose to prominence with her role as Tina Lord on the ABC daytime drama “One Life to Live” from 1979 to 1981. She reprised the role in 1985 and received a Daytime Emmy Award nomination three years later for her portrayal of the troubled character.

Challenges and Personal Struggles:

In the 1990s, Evans abruptly left “One Life to Live” after being confronted by a stalker. The incident took place in a Manhattan studio, and she subsequently received death threats, some written in blood, according to the Hollywood Reporter. The traumatic experience deeply affected Evans, leading her to withdraw from the public eye.

Life Beyond the Limelight:

Following her departure from “One Life to Live,” Evans maintained a private life away from the public spotlight. In 2008, she explained to People magazine that her decision to keep a low profile was influenced by her encounter with the stalker, stating that it had forever changed her and left an indelible impact.

A Lasting Legacy in Soap Opera:

Although she limited her public appearances, Evans made a guest appearance as Tina on “One Life to Live” in 2008. In addition to her iconic role on the show, she played Rebecca Hotchkiss on “Passions” and portrayed Patty Williams in “The Young and the Restless.” Her final acting credit was on the Prime series “The Bay” from 2017 to 2020.

Family and Loved Ones:

Andrea Evans is survived by her husband, Stephen Rodriguez, whom she married in 1998. The couple shared a daughter named Kylie. Prior to her marriage to Rodriguez, Evans was married to her “One Life to Live” co-star Wayne Massey from 1981 to 1983.
